CITY OF PASSAIC BOARD OF ADJUSTMENT MINUTES The City of Passaic Board of Adjustments held a regular meeting on November 26th, 2019 in the Council Chambers, City Hall, 330 Passaic Street at 7:30 p.m. and opened the meeting at 7:49 p.m. by requesting a roll call. Docket #ZB19-07, 235 Lexington Avenue, Block#4105.01 Lot#65, in the O-R Zone, applicant Little Prints Daycare II LLC is requesting preliminary & final site plan approval and D (2) Expansion of Non-Conforming Use Variance to expand a pre-existing Day Care facility. This application will also need variances for minimum lot area, lot width, side yard, lot coverage, building height, parking and any other variances and/or waivers that may be required. Approved on September 17th, 2019. A motion to approve the Resolution of 235 Lexington Avenue, was made by 1|P age CITY OF PASSAIC BOARD OF ADJUSTMENT MINUTES Commissioner Brisman, seconded by Commissioner Blumenthal, on a roll call vote, all in favor the motion passed. 2. Docket #ZB19-06, 63 Central Avenue, Block #4111.01, Lot# 37 in the M1 Zone District, applicant Antonio Sanchez of Brown Soul Tattoo 3 LLC, is seeking to establish a tattoo parlor, which is a conditional use of the M1 zone. The applicant is seeking a D (3) conditional use variance for store distance limitation which falls within 500 feet of a church, public and/or private school and any residential zone in the area and any other variance and/or waivers that may be required. Approved on September 17th, 2019 with conditions. A motion to approve the Resolution of 63 Central Avenue, was made by Commissioner Stareshefsky, seconded by Commissioner Blumenthal, on a roll call vote, all in favor the motion passed. Docket #ZB13-08, 705-713 River Drive, Block 1326, Lot 1, in the M-1 Zone, Applicant River Drive Associates, LLC, is seeking site plan approval, a D (1) use variance, along with variances for front yard, parking, and any other variances that may be required to utilize the property as a junkyard. ADJOURNED FROM JANUARY 29TH, 2019. CARRIED FROM AUGUST 20TH, TO BE ADJOURNED TO OCTOBER 7TH, 2019. Item #1 of the agenda was read in the record. Mr. Charles Sarlo, Esq., attorney for the applicant, Mr. Bruce Rosenberg, Opposing Counsel & Mr. Phillip LaPorta, Esq. Opposing Counsel for the Borough of Rutherford, were present at this hearing. Chairman Bazian advised the Board, applicants, opponents and the public this application has come to it’s completion and now the attorney and opposing counsel will summarize their case. Mr. Laporte began his summation. Mr. Rosenberg gave his summation. Mr. Sarlo concluded the summations. D.Kinz, Board Attorney addressed the Board & all counsel and provided his legal opinion. He advised the Board will need to determine if the property is a junk yard. Chairman Bazian asked the Board for their determination. Commissioner Brisman had comments and his opinion for the Board. A motion to affirm the property 705-713 River Drive is indeed a junkyard, made by Commissioner Brisman seconded by Commissioner Soto, on a roll call vote, all in favor the motion passed. Commissioner Stareshefsky expressed his opinion as well. Commissioner Soto had comments and opinions as well. Commissioner Blumenthal had comments. 2|P age CITY OF PASSAIC BOARD OF ADJUSTMENT MINUTES D.Kinz, Board Attorney had additional recommendations for the Board. The Board imposed the following conditions: 1. Butler Building must be built within 6 months of all final approvals. 2. Our approval contingent on other approvals from other Agencies. 3. Landscaping Plan A motion to approve the application of 705-713 River Drive with conditions, made by Commissioner Brisman seconded by Vice Chairman , on a roll call vote, all in favor the motion passed. 4. Docket #ZB19-04, 64 Broadway, Block 2152 Lot(s) 32 in the C-R Zone District, Applicant Shree Vasudev Krishnay LLC. is requesting preliminary and final site plan approval and D (5) density variance, to convert an existing office space on 2nd floor and 3rd floor into a residential apartments for a total of three (3) residential units and commercial units on the first floor along with variances for lot size, lot width, lot depth, front yard setback, rear yard setback, side yard setbacks, lot coverage, open space, parking and any other variances and/or waivers that may be required. FIRST APPEARANCE. TO BE CARRIED TO SEPTEMBER 5TH, 2019, TO BE CARRIED TO SEPTEMBER 17TH, 2019. Item #7 of the agenda was read in the record. Mr. Gary E. Cohen, Esq., attorney for the applicant was present at the hearing. Mr. Cohen has requested the hearing to be adjourned to July 9th. A motion to table and then recall the application of 64 Broadway, was made by Commissioner Stareshefsky seconded by Commissioner Graham-Woodson, on a roll call vote, all in favor the motion passed. Mr. Allende Matos, Licensed Architect & Professional Planner of Passaic, NJ was sworn into the record. Mr. Matos has presented befor this Board on various occasions. The Board accepted his qualifications. Mr. Matos continued with his testimony. Mr. Matos described the property and the proposed plan. Commissioner Stareshefsky had questions for our R. Fernandez, Board Planner regarding the (d) variance required. He also had questions for the witness Mr. Matos. 3|P age CITY OF PASSAIC BOARD OF ADJUSTMENT MINUTES Chairman Bazian had questions for Mr. Matos. Commissioner Stareshefsky had follow-up questions. R.Fernandez, Board Planner had questions for Mr. Matos regarding the length of vacancy and have they tried to acquire parking spaces for the property. He wanted to clarify the amount for the parking space requirement. Commissioner Brisman had comments for the Board. R.Fernandez, Board Planner had additional comments for the Board. Chairman Bazian opened the public portion of the hearing. Steven Siklosi, resident of 23 Orchard Street had several questions for the applicant. A motion to close the public portion of the 64 Broadway hearing was made by Commissioner Stareshefsky, seconded by Commissioner Blumenthal, on a roll call vote, all in favor the motion passed. The Board imposed a Payment in Lieu of Parking Fee of $30,000.00 to be paid before obtaining Certificate of Occupancy. A motion to approve application of 64 Broadway, was made by Commissioner Soto, seconded by Commissioner Stareshefsky, on a roll call vote, all in favor the motion passed.
